Golf Test Drive: Nike SQ DYMO STR8-FIT Beats the TaylorMade R9

When I hit a golf ball at full power, my drive distance is 230-250 yards. That’s how far I’ve hit it for years with the Callaway sitting in my golf bag, and that is the way it was the TaylorMade R9 I demoed during three trips to the range this weekend. My one gripe with these two clubs is that I have natural left to right slice, making it a crap shoot as to whether or not the ball will land on the fairway, and neither of them do much (if anything) to help me straighten out my shot. Then I tried the Nike SQ DYMO STR8-FIT

Upon hitting the Nike SQ DYMO STR8-FIT driver for the first time, I noticed how smooth the ball comes off the club. After hitting about half the bucket of balls on day one I decided to get experimental and cut my swing power down to about 80% – and this is where hitting the new Nike club got very interesting.

Usually when I “take a little off” my swing, the ball hooks to either the right or left – or goes straight, but travels a measly 180 yards.

Taking a little off my swing with the Nike driver allowed the juiced-up, larger than life head on the club and the stiff shaft to naturally correct the flaws in my swing and made the ball travel my standard 230-250 years, but straight nearly 100-percent of the time. (more…)

2009 Masters Badges Cheapest Ever!

masters-leadIf you ever dreamed of walking the 12th hole of the Augusta National Golf Course during the Masters Tournament but the price was certain to your ass ’til Tuesday, then today is that day.  Never before in the history of the 75 year-old tournament have badges been so cheap and easily obtainable to the general public .  Blame the ecomomy, blame AIG or blame Congress for calling out corporate executives on their frivolous spending habits and ridiculously excessive bonuses, but the fact of the matter is, demand is way down and the opportunity exists for fans to attend the last two days of the Granddaddy of All Golf Tournaments for as less than half of the price of years past.

One day badges  for Thursday and Friday, which typically run between $1000 to $2000 a day sold on the secondary market for $175 to $500. Prices for the weekend are expected to remain about the same, but buyer beware.  Brokers on the web are continuing to post ridiculous prices hoping to catch a few last-minute diehards still packing expendable incomes. Watch The Masters On Your iPhone

masters-app

Want to watch the Master golf tournament (which started today, BTW) but aren’t anywhere near a television? Fear not – you can now watch (some of) the Masters straight from your iPhone! The Masters iPhone app will show you live broadcast coverage of the holes 11, 12, 13, 15 and 16, plus on-demand video highlights at the end of each day of competition. It also gives you easy access to the “leaderboard, player scorecards, stats and bios, news updates, tournament photos, video archives, and a course map of August National Golf Club.”

Why the United States Will Win the Ryder Cup

Every two years the best golfers from the United States and Europe compete in a three day competition for the coveted Ryder Cup. Before 1979 the United States absolutely dominated the competition but recently the Europeans have owned the cup.  Since 1997 the Europeans have won the Ryder Cup four out of the last five matches.  This year’s American team boasts six rookies to the squad making the United States an underdog for the first time.
